Japanese tourism and retail shares dived on Monday after China warned its citizens to avoid the tourist hot spot in a spat over Prime Minister Sanae Takaichi¡¯s comments on Taiwan.

A senior Japanese official meanwhile arrived in China seeking to defuse the row sparked by Takaichi¡¯s suggestion that Tokyo could intervene militarily in any attack on the self-ruled island.

Asia¡¯s two top economies are closely entwined, with China the biggest source of tourists ¡ª almost 7.5 million visitors in the first nine months of 2025 ¡ª coming to Japan.
